SOCIAL SECURITY NUMBER:A Social Security number (SSN#) is an identification
number required for working in the US. If you plan to engage in lawful
employment, you will need to obtain a Social Security number. The
Social Security Administration holds the view that a Social Security Number
should be issued only for employment reasons. You must have proof of employment to obtain a Social
Security number. ALL persons seeking employment of any kind must obtain
a Social Security Number before payment can be received.Students at CSUB on F-1 or J-1 visas are eligible
for a Social Security number. J-2 dependents are eligible and can apply for a
Social Security Number if they have received work authorization from USCIS.
F-2 dependents are not eligible for a Social Security number. Although students authorized
to work must obtain a Social Security card, contributions for Social Security
and Medi-Cal should not be withheld from wages. Be sure to inform your
employer before beginning employment.
It is not necessary to have a social security number to open a bank account.
The Social Security office will not issue you a social security card for
banking purposes. You should obtain an Individual Taxpayer Identification
Number (ITIN) from the US Internal Revenue Service (IRS). The form to obtain
an ITIN number can be obtained from the bank or the IRS website at
www.irs.gov
The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) normally requires a Social Security
Number to obtain a California Driver's License; however, international
students are not eligible to obtain a number for this purpose. If the DMV
tells you that a Social Security number is required, you must tell them you
are not eligible for a number. They should then allow you to proceed with
your application.TO
APPLY:
To apply for a Social Security Number, you must provide original documents
showing your age, identity, immigration status, and proof that CSUB has
authorized you to work either on or off-campus as well as a letter from the
Office of ISP.You must apply in
